How much does roof replacement cost in Star Lake?

Roof replacement costs in Star Lake typically range from $8,000 to $25,000, depending on your home’s size, roof complexity, and material choice. A standard 1,500 square foot home with asphalt shingles usually falls between $12,000 and $18,000.The price includes tear-off of old materials, new underlayment, shingles, flashing, and proper disposal. Factors like roof pitch, number of penetrations, and accessibility affect the final cost. We provide detailed estimates that break down all costs upfront so you know exactly what you’re paying for.
A quality roof installation in Star Lake typically lasts 20-30 years with asphalt shingles, and 40-70 years with metal roofing. Washington’s wet climate requires proper installation and materials rated for high moisture exposure.The key is using adequate underlayment, proper ventilation, and quality flashing around chimneys, vents, and valleys. Poor installation can cut a roof’s lifespan in half, while quality workmanship with appropriate materials maximizes your investment. Regular maintenance like gutter cleaning and minor repairs extends roof life significantly.
Asphalt shingles remain the most popular choice for Star Lake homes due to their cost-effectiveness and reliable performance in wet climates. Architectural shingles offer better wind resistance and longer warranties than basic three-tab shingles.Metal roofing performs exceptionally well in the Pacific Northwest, lasting decades longer than asphalt while handling heavy rain and wind storms effectively. Cedar shakes provide traditional Northwest aesthetics but require more maintenance. We help you choose materials based on your budget, home style, and long-term goals.

Yes, we work directly with insurance companies to help process storm damage and other covered roof repairs. We document damage thoroughly, provide detailed estimates that match insurance requirements, and communicate directly with adjusters.Most insurance policies cover sudden damage from storms, falling trees, or other unexpected events. Gradual wear and maintenance issues typically aren’t covered. We help you understand what your policy covers and ensure all necessary documentation gets submitted properly to maximize your claim approval.
